Rhoma Irama's Son Detained for Drug Possession
Jakarta. Dangdut singer Muhammad Ridho Rhoma will remain in custody for 20 days, after he was nabbed in a drug raid in West Jakarta on Friday (24/03).
According to the police, Ridho, son of Indonesia's "Dangdut King" and chairman of newly established Idaman Party, Rhoma Irama, will be questioned and tested for drugs by the National Narcotics Agency (BNN).
"In Ridho Rhoma's case, the BNN will take hair and urine samples. It is still a preliminary investigation. His detention period starts today," Jakarta Police spokesman Sr. Comr. Raden Prabowo Argo Yuwono said on Monday.
Ridho was arrested for possession of crystal methamphetamine at the Ibis Hotel Daan Mogot.
"He will be detained by the West Jakarta Police. In drug cases, detention period starts three days after the arrest," Argo added.
Ridho's family has pleaded for the young singer to be sent into a rehabilitation camp.
"It can be done in accordance with the regulations, but we will need an assessment from the BNN," Argo said.
Initial investigation revealed Ridho bought a 0.7 gram pack of crystal meth from a drug dealer known as M.S. for Rp 1.8 million ($135).
Police have also arrested the dealer.
"There are also other suspects whom we are pursuing to find out where the drugs came from," Argo said.
